Over the past 30 years, there have been 43 property sales recorded in the N5 1PL postcode area. The highest sale price reached £1,670,000, while the most recent sale was for a terraced flat sold in March 2025 for £545,000.
The estimated average property value in N5 1PL currently stands at £792,953, which is approximately 9.4%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£10,686.
Property prices in N5 1PL have risen by 0.1% over the past year , with a total increase of 2.1%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 8.8%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is flat, making up around 86% of transactions , followed by terraced and other.
Housing in N5 1PL is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 75% of homes being lived in by the owners.
